cancel
Showing results for 
Search instead for 
Did you mean: 

VxVM vxdisksetup ERROR V-5-2-43 on newly replaced disks.

David_Freer
Level 2
Fresh HPUX install, now trying to configure VxVM:
 
# vxdisk list
DEVICE       TYPE            DISK         GROUP        STATUS
c4t0d0       auto:hpdisk     rootdisk01   rootdg       online
c4t1d0       auto:cdsdisk    -            -            online
c4t2d0       auto:cdsdisk    -            -            online
c4t3d0       auto:cdsdisk    -            -            online
c4t5d0       auto:cdsdisk    -            -            online
c4t6d0       auto:cdsdisk    -            -            online
c5t8d0       auto:cdsdisk    -            -            online
c5t9d0       auto:cdsdisk    -            -            online
c6t1d0       auto:cdsdisk    -            -            online
c6t2d0       auto:cdsdisk    -            -            online
c6t3d0       auto:cdsdisk    -            -            online
c6t4d0       auto:cdsdisk    -            -            online
c6t5d0       auto:cdsdisk    -            -            online
c6t6d0       auto:cdsdisk    -            -            online
c7t8d0       auto:cdsdisk    -            -            online
c7t9d0       auto:cdsdisk    -            -            online
c7t10d0      auto:none       -            -            online invalid
Note that c4t4d0, c6t0d0 & c5t10d0 are all missing from vxdisk list.
 
# ioscan -fnC disk
Class     I  H/W Path       Driver S/W State   H/W Type     Description
=======================================================================
disk      0  0/0/2/1.2.0    sdisk CLAIMED     DEVICE       HP      DVD-ROM 305
                           /dev/dsk/c3t2d0   /dev/dvd-rom      /dev/rdsk/c3t2d0
disk      1  0/10/0/0.0.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c4t0d0   /dev/rdsk/c4t0d0
disk      2  0/10/0/0.1.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c4t1d0   /dev/rdsk/c4t1d0
disk      3  0/10/0/0.2.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c4t2d0   /dev/rdsk/c4t2d0
disk      4  0/10/0/0.3.0   sdisk CLAIMED     DEVICE       FUJITSU MAW3073NC
                           /dev/dsk/c4t3d0   /dev/rdsk/c4t3d0
disk      5  0/10/0/0.4.0   sdisk CLAIMED     DEVICE       FUJITSU MAW3073NC
                           /dev/dsk/c4t4d0   /dev/rdsk/c4t4d0
disk      6  0/10/0/0.5.0   sdisk CLAIMED     DEVICE       HP 36.4GMAP3367NC
                           /dev/dsk/c4t5d0   /dev/rdsk/c4t5d0
disk      7  0/10/0/0.6.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c4t6d0   /dev/rdsk/c4t6d0
disk     15  0/10/0/1.8.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c5t8d0   /dev/rdsk/c5t8d0
disk     16  0/10/0/1.9.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c5t9d0   /dev/rdsk/c5t9d0
disk     17  0/10/0/1.10.0  sdisk CLAIMED     DEVICE       FUJITSU MAW3073NC
                           /dev/dsk/c5t10d0   /dev/rdsk/c5t10d0
disk      8  0/12/0/0.0.0   sdisk CLAIMED     DEVICE       FUJITSU MAW3073NC
                           /dev/dsk/c6t0d0   /dev/rdsk/c6t0d0
disk      9  0/12/0/0.1.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t1d0   /dev/rdsk/c6t1d0
disk     10  0/12/0/0.2.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t2d0   /dev/rdsk/c6t2d0
disk     11  0/12/0/0.3.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t3d0   /dev/rdsk/c6t3d0
disk     12  0/12/0/0.4.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t4d0   /dev/rdsk/c6t4d0
disk     13  0/12/0/0.5.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t5d0   /dev/rdsk/c6t5d0
disk     14  0/12/0/0.6.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c6t6d0   /dev/rdsk/c6t6d0
disk     18  0/12/0/1.8.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c7t8d0   /dev/rdsk/c7t8d0
disk     19  0/12/0/1.9.0   s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c7t9d0   /dev/rdsk/c7t9d0
disk     20  0/12/0/1.10.0  sdisk CLAIMED     DEVICE       HP 36.4GST336607LC
                           /dev/dsk/c7t10d0   /dev/rdsk/c7t10d0
 
There are no /etc/vx/*.exclude files, and /etc/vx/disk.info does not list the missing drives. vxconfigd -k, vxdisk scandisks and vxdctl enable have all been attempted to sort this out but without success.
 
# /etc/vx/bin/vxdisksetup -i c4t4d0
VxVM vxdisksetup ERROR V-5-2-43 c4t4d0: Invalid disk device for vxdisksetup
 
Any suggestions?
 
Thanks,
 
David.
3 REPLIES 3

David_Freer
Level 2
Found the problem, VxVM is seeing c4t3d0 as ALL of the replaced disks. How can this be undone?
 
# vxdisk list c4t3d0
Device:    c4t3d0
devicetag: c4t3d0
type:      auto
hostid:
disk:      name= id=1203411685.113.loopback
group:     name= id=1203410389.103.loopback
info:      format=cdsdisk,privoffset=128
flags:     online ready private autoconfig
pubpaths:  block=/dev/vx/dmp/c4t3d0 char=/dev/vx/rdmp/c4t3d0
version:   3.1
iosize:    min=512 (bytes) max=256 (blocks)
public:    slice=0 offset=1152 len=71815272 disk_offset=0
private:   slice=0 offset=128 len=1024 disk_offset=0
update:    time=1203943437 seqno=0.14
ssb:       actual_seqno=0.1
headers:   0 120
configs:   count=1 len=640
logs:      count=1 len=96
Defined regions:
 config   priv 000024-000119[000096]: copy=01 offset=000000 enabled
 config   priv 000128-000671[000544]: copy=01 offset=000096 enabled
 log      priv 000672-000767[000096]: copy=01 offset=000000 enabled
 lockrgn  priv 000768-000839[000072]: part=00 offset=000000
Multipathing information:
numpaths:   4
c4t3d0  state=enabled
c4t4d0  state=enabled
c5t10d0 state=enabled
c6t0d0  state=enabled

sunshine_2
Level 4
as seen in the # vxdisk list c4t3d0

Multipathing information:
numpaths:   4
c4t3d0  state=enabled   -   primary disk path
c4t4d0  state=enabled   -   secondary path for the c4t3d0  disk
c5t10d0 state=enabled   -   secondary path for the c4t3d0  disk
c6t0d0  state=enabled   -   secondary path for the c4t3d0  disk

you can also confirm by running

# vxdisk path or vxdisk -e list or

vxdmpadm getdmpnode enclosure=<enclosure name>

you can get the enclosure name from

vxdmpadm listctlr all

Jeffrey_S
Level 2
I'm assuming you've fixed this, but did you try killing vxconfigd, removing /etc/vx/disk.info and then restarting vxconfigd to recreate the disk.info file?